How a Criminal Attorney in Kearney, MO Can Help

There are reasons everyone has a right to effective legal representation, and there are various ways a criminal attorney can help your case:

Delay or Stop Charges From Being Filed

After you’ve been detained, a criminal attorney can talk to a prosecutor or district attorney in Kearney, MO, show them evidence that corroborates your side of the story, and convince them to drop the charges or charge you with a less serious crime.

Protect Your Rights

When Kearney, MO law enforcement believes they have made a legitimate arrest, they’ll go to great lengths to obtain the evidence needed to bring formal charges. According to a 1969 Supreme Court Decision, police are even permitted to lie during interrogations. Investigate Your Case

A criminal attorney in Kearney, MO will conduct a thorough investigation, often more in-depth than that of the detectives and prostitution, in an effort to uncover physical evidence and witnesses that are beneficial to your case. We’ll also be critical of the state’s investigation, and see if any of your rights were violated or if the state’s case does not add up.

Develop a Defense Strategy

Different cases are best defended in different ways, depending on the severity of the alleged crimes and the evidence the state is using. In some cases, we may recommend to accept a plea deal. We may request a more lenient sentence because of special factors in your life and in the case. Other times it might be possible to prove you could not have committed the crime or, if we proceed to trial, convince a jury that the burden of proof of beyond a reasonable doubt has not been met. Did you have a reliable alibi? Was key evidence contaminated? Is there somebody else that may have committed the crime? We’ll do everything possible to persuade a jury they cannot morally find you guilty with what was presented in court.

Give You Dependable Legal Advice

A Combs Waterkotte criminal attorney will be truthful with you about the odds of success for different defense strategies. We know everyone wants to be found “not guilty,” or have their charges dismissed. However, sometimes it may make the most sense for you, your family and your freedom to choose another strategy. No matter what, the choice of how to approach your defense is in your hands.

Public Defender or a Private Kearney, MO, MO Criminal Attorney?

The option of a free public defender can be attractive, but the truth is you’ll have a better chance of success by hiring a private Kearney, MO criminal attorney like those at Combs Waterkotte. For starters, public defenders often have enormous case loads. A 2014 Study of the Missouri Public Defender System reported that Kearney, MO public defenders largely do not have enough time to come up with a quality defense. While there are excellent criminal attorneys in the public defense system, they are human and the realities of their job may keep them from devoting the best defense possible.

Another study found that the state is give better deals to defendants with a private criminal attorney than one who has a public defender. It also stated that incarceration is, on average, five years less with a private attorney, despite private attorneys generally taking on more serious cases.
